Device Description
The VIVA combo RF System consists of RF generator, active electrode, grounding pad and peristaltic pump for electrode cooling. This device is designed to produce local tissue heating at the tip of the electrodes causing the coagulation and ablation of tissue. VIVA combo RF System is capable of delivering up to 200 W of RF power and the available power is limited through software control. This system monitors the power, resistance, current and temperature. The active electrodes are a sterile, single-use, hand-held electrosurgical instrument designed for use with VIVA combo RF System. Cooling of the electrode is provided by chilled water which is pumped through the inflow tubing, the electrode and out through the outflow tubing. This is an enclosed system within the electrode and the water is not to be in contact with the patient. VIVA combo RF System consists of S_VCS_F, MRFALogger and STAR Logger. The S VCS F software continuously monitors impedance, current, power and temperature. The unit automatically monitors rises in impedance and adjust RF output accordingly. MRFALogger software can be stored and monitored on PC or tablet the RF output parameter (power, impedance, current, temperature and energy). STAR Logger can be stored and monitored on a tablet PC the RF output parameter (power, impedance, current, temperature and energy).

8. Technological Characteristics

No changes have been made to the technological characteristics of the device.

9. Comparison to the Predicate Device

The modified device has no design changes comparing with previous one. But replaced software VIVA Logger software with STAR Logger for using tablet with device.

Software architecture changes: The purpose of STAR Logger is to provide convenience for the user by displaying certain data that is also shown on the VIVA combo RF Generator. The VIVA combo RF generator communicates with the software via a USB communication cable or RS232 to USB converter using serial communication.

Software: replaced VIVA Logger software with STAR Logger.

10. Summary of Non-Clinical Testing

Software verification and validation was conducted on the changed to VIVA combo RF System software to validate it for its intended use per the design documentation in line with recommendations outlined in General Principles of Software Validation, Guidance for Industry and FDA staff. The VIVA combo RF System demonstrated passing results on all applicable testing.

12. Conclusion

The subject device(VIVA combo RF System) and its predicate have the same indication and principle of operation, and identical technological characteristics. The minor difference in the newer device version is to using replaced software STAR Logger with tablet PC which do not present different questions of safety or effectiveness as compared to the predicate device. Verification testing according to the company's design control procedures demonstrates that the subject device is as safe and effective as its predicate device. Thus, the subject device is substantially equivalent to its predicate device.
